Mococo is teaming up with Howawa for a dynamic off-collab, happening on April 2nd, 2026. Sources confirm that they plan to clear the game together, adding excitement to the community. Fans are rallying behind this collaboration, especially given Subaruโs involvement to support Mococo.
Mococo's off-collaboration was announced recently, sparking conversations across various forums. Fans express their enthusiasm, while others share mixed feelings about Subaru's role in this venture.
